bunny by mona awad

***contains spoilers***
bunny by mona awad was an absolute trip, to say the least. i had no idea the kind of journey i was about to embark on when this book was chosen for book club.
quick synopsis
in the beginning chapters, i was instantly reminded of a heathers/ mean girls type story - outcast, gloomy, loner type protagonist (samantha) with great potential but not-so-great circumstances and the wealthy, beautiful cultish group (the bunnies) that the main character hates but secretly wants to be a part of. the story takes place at warren university (warren? like rabbit hole??) where samantha and the bunnies are part of a prestigious writing program, and even in the same writing cohort. right away, samantha struck me as a biased and unreliable (and insufferable) narrator, and even to the very end of the story, i am still unsure of what actually happened and what was part of her wild imagination.
samantha spends a good part of the beginning of the book detailing her hatred for the bunnies and explaining the objectifying nicknames she gave them - cupcake, creepy dolls, vignette and the duchess. this is only fueled by her best and only friend, ava, who is just as "dark", "angry" and "distant" as her.
when samantha receives an invitation to a bunny get-together though, everything changes. and this is when we really start to descend down the rabbit hole...
themes
individualism vs collectivism, loneliness/longing, transformation, mental health/schizophrenia
criticisms
if i had to offer one criticism to this novel, i'd say that almost the entirety of the story revolved around women and their complex friendships and relationships with one another, and at the end of the story, it still feels like the day was saved by a man. yes, this character is supposed to be the embodiment of samantha's courage and desires, but he's the one who ultimately unravels the bunny's tight-knit clique? this was a little disappointing to me.
conclusions
overall, i enjoyed this read. the author's writing style was very entertaining and kept the reader engaged. some parts were a little hard to follow (purposefully), but the twists and turns of this book kept me turning each page.
rating: 3.8/5 ⭐️
recommend: yes
